How Many Validators Does Solana Have?

Importance of Validator Count to Stakeholders

The number of validators on a blockchain network like Solana serves as a fundamental metric that significantly influences the network's overall health and operational efficiency. For investors, traders, and users, understanding the validator count provides crucial insights into the network's reliability and future potential.

Validators are the backbone of any Proof of Stake (PoS) blockchain network, and their quantity directly impacts several critical aspects:

  • Decentralization: A higher number of validators substantially enhances the decentralization of the network. This distribution of power reduces the risk of single points of failure and increases the network's resistance to censorship attempts. When validator nodes are spread across different geographical locations and operated by diverse entities, the network becomes more resilient against coordinated attacks or regional disruptions.

  • Security: The security architecture of a Proof of Stake network such as Solana directly correlates with the number of active validators. A larger validator set makes it exponentially more difficult for any single entity or coordinated group to gain control over the majority of the network's stake. This distributed security model ensures that malicious actors would need to compromise a significant portion of validators to threaten network integrity, which becomes increasingly impractical as the validator count grows.

  • Network Performance: Validators play an indispensable role in processing transactions and creating new blocks on the blockchain. A robust and well-distributed network of validators can dramatically improve the overall speed, reliability, and throughput of transaction processing. This performance enhancement directly translates to better user experiences and enables the network to handle higher transaction volumes during peak demand periods.

Data and Statistics

The growth trajectory of Solana validators can be clearly observed through quantitative analysis of the network's expansion over recent years. In recent years, the Solana network has experienced remarkable growth in its validator ecosystem, with the network currently supported by approximately 1,700 active validators. This number represents a substantial increase from earlier periods and reflects the growing adoption and confidence in the Solana ecosystem.

Examining the historical progression provides valuable context:

  • 2021: Approximately 200 validators formed the foundation of the network
  • 2023: The validator count had grown to around 900, representing a 350% increase
  • Recent years: The network now maintains approximately 1,700 validators, nearly doubling from 2023

This data demonstrates not only a steady and consistent increase in validator numbers but also reflects growing trust and sustained interest in the Solana network from the global blockchain community. Each validator contributes to the network's total stake, and in recent years, the total value staked on the Solana network has been estimated to exceed $40 billion. This substantial economic engagement indicates strong commitment from the global crypto community and validates the network's value proposition.

The geographical distribution of these validators has also improved significantly, with validator nodes operating across multiple continents and regions. This global distribution enhances network resilience and ensures that the network can maintain operations even if specific regions experience technical difficulties or regulatory challenges.
